#6e3bcd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6e3bcd is composed of 43.1% red, 23.1%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.3% cyan, 71.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 261 degrees, a saturation of 59.3% and a lightness of 51.8%. #6e3bcd color hex could be obtained by blending #dc76ff with #00009b.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#6e3bcd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6e3bcd has RGB values of R:110, G:59,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.71,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 7224269.

Shades and Tints of #6e3bcd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040207 is the darkest color, while #f9f7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#6e3bcd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#827d8b is the less saturated color, while #600cfc is the most saturated one.
